Forecast: Turnover of Sea and Coastal Freight Water Transport in Spain

The turnover of sea and coastal freight water transport in Spain is forecasted to reach 1.48 billion Euros in 2024, reflecting a 2.0% annual increase from 2023. This growth trend is expected to continue with yearly increments of 1.5%, 1.3%, 1.3%, and 1.3% through 2025 to 2028 respectively, culminating in a value of 1.57 billion Euros by 2028. Over the last two years, the industry has seen a consistent rise, indicating a stable growth trajectory.

Looking ahead, several future trends should be closely monitored:

  • Technological advancements in shipping and logistics, which could enhance efficiency and reduce operational costs.
  • Environmental regulations aimed at reducing carbon emissions and their impact on operational processes and costs.
  • Global economic conditions and trade agreements that could affect freight volumes and demand for sea and coastal transport services.
  • Investment in port infrastructure and digitalization to support increased freight traffic and improve turnaround times.
